To help you avoid these pitfalls, we\u2019ve compiled a list of the most common mistakes and how to prevent them.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#1 \u2013 Waiting Until the Last Minute to Book<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>One of the biggest mistakes travelers make is delaying their parking reservation. The closer you get to your departure date, the higher the prices climb. Booking in advance can save you up to 50% compared to paying on the day of your flight. Additionally, late bookings mean fewer available options, forcing you to settle for off-site parking that may require a lengthy shuttle transfer.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To avoid this mistake, book your parking as soon as you confirm your flight. Many providers allow free cancellations, so there\u2019s no risk in securing a spot early. Also, consider using price comparison websites to monitor deals and lock in the best rates.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#2 \u2013 Choosing the Wrong Type of Parking<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Manchester Airport offers a range of parking options, and picking the wrong one can lead to unnecessary expenses or inconvenience. Short-stay parking is great for quick drop-offs but is too expensive for long trips. Long-stay parking is ideal for extended vacations but may require a shuttle ride. Meet-and-greet services offer convenience but at a premium price, while park-and-ride is a budget-friendly choice, though it requires extra travel time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To make the right choice, consider your travel needs. If you\u2019re traveling for business and need to save time, meet-and-greet might be worth the extra cost. For holidaymakers looking to save money, long-stay or park-and-ride options are better suited. Be sure to check for any hidden fees, such as extra charges for late pick-ups or oversized vehicles.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#3 \u2013 Not Checking for Discounts or Deals<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Many travelers overpay for airport parking simply because they don\u2019t look for discounts. Manchester Airport often offers promotional rates on its official website, and third-party comparison sites like ParkVia and JustPark can help find cheaper alternatives. Promo codes and seasonal discounts are also common, so it\u2019s always worth doing a quick search before booking.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Frequent travelers should consider joining loyalty programs or using travel credit cards that offer airport parking perks. Some providers also give discounts for group bookings or off-peak travel. Spending a few extra minutes looking for deals can lead to significant savings.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#4 \u2013 Ignoring Security Features of the Parking Facility<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Security should be a top priority when choosing airport parking. Many travelers assume that all airport parking facilities are safe, but this isn\u2019t always the case. Choosing a poorly secured or unregulated parking lot increases the risk of theft, vandalism, or even car damage.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Before booking, check if the facility has CCTV surveillance, gated entry, and on-site security staff. Official Manchester Airport parking tends to have higher security standards, but if you\u2019re using a third-party provider, research their reputation first. Reading customer reviews can help you determine whether a parking facility is safe and trustworthy.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#5 \u2013 Falling for Scam Parking Operators<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>In recent years, there have been multiple reports of rogue parking companies scamming unsuspecting travelers. These fraudulent operators often advertise low rates but leave vehicles in unsecured, unmonitored areas\u2014sometimes even on public streets! Some have even been caught taking customer cars for personal use while the owners were away.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To avoid falling for a scam, always book through reputable websites and avoid deals that seem too good to be true. Official airport parking, well-known third-party providers, and services with strong customer reviews are your safest options. If a company doesn\u2019t have a physical address or a professional website, consider it a red flag.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#6 \u2013 Forgetting to Check the Distance from the Terminal<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Not all parking facilities are within walking distance of the terminals. Many off-site options require shuttle transfers, and some travelers don\u2019t realize how long these transfers take until they arrive. If you choose off-site parking, check the estimated transfer time and whether the shuttle runs 24\/7.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#7 \u2013 Overlooking Cancellation and Refund Policies<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Many travelers book airport parking without checking the cancellation policy, assuming they won\u2019t need to make changes. However, unexpected situations\u2014such as flight cancellations or rescheduling\u2014can arise, leaving you stuck with a non-refundable booking.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Before confirming your parking, read the provider\u2019s terms and conditions. Some companies offer flexible bookings that allow free cancellations or changes, while others charge hefty fees. Choosing a flexible option might cost slightly more upfront but can save you money in case your plans change.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#8 \u2013 Not Reading Customer Reviews<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Customer reviews can reveal a lot about a parking provider\u2019s reliability, security, and overall service. Many travelers skip this step, only to discover hidden issues upon arrival\u2014such as poor security, long shuttle wait times, or unhelpful staff.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Before booking, check reviews on Google, Trustpilot, or TripAdvisor. If a provider has a consistent pattern of complaints, consider looking elsewhere. A few negative reviews are normal, but multiple reports of lost keys, damaged vehicles, or poor service should be a red flag.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#9 \u2013 Misunderstanding Pick-Up and Drop-Off Rules<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Manchester Airport has strict rules for dropping off and picking up passengers, and failure to follow them can result in unexpected fees. Many travelers assume they can stop outside the terminal for free, only to be hit with high charges for exceeding the time limit.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To avoid unnecessary costs, familiarize yourself with the airport\u2019s official drop-off and pick-up zones. If you plan to park for an extended period, ensure you choose a suitable parking option rather than relying on short-stay areas.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Mistake #10 \u2013 Forgetting to Note Parking Location<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>It may sound simple, but many travelers forget where they parked their car, leading to unnecessary stress after a long flight.
